Sync top level files with gcc.
Import these patches from the GCC mainline: 2016-01-12 Andris Pavenis <andris.pavenis@iki.fi> * configure.ac: Enable LTO for DJGPP * configure: Regenerate 2016-01-24 Mikhail Maltsev <maltsevm@gmail.com> PR bootstrap/69329 * Makefile.tpl (BASE_FLAGS_TO_PASS): Add LSAN_OPTIONS. * Makefile.in: Regenerate. 2016-01-25 Aditya Kumar <aditya.k7@samsung.com> Sebastian Pop <s.pop@samsung.com> * Makefile.in: Regenerate. * Makefile.tpl: Export ISLVER. * configure: Regenerate. * config/isl.m4: Detect isl-0.15. 2016-01-29 Sebastian Pop <s.pop@samsung.com> * config/isl.m4: Add comments about isl-0.16. * configure: Regenerate.
